Who is this person? He was the most unlucky general in the Three Kingdoms, and he had changed leaders 5 times, but none of them were reliable, and he was eventually killed alive! This person is Liao Hua.

Liao Hua is a man with a flexible mind, and he will not be limited by the so-called secular etiquette. Born in a chaotic world, in order to survive, Liao Hua focused on hundreds of people, and he acted as the leader in them.

Quote: "Gang Shi wandered into the rivers and lakes, gathered more than 500 people, and plundered for a living. ”,

First of all, it solves the needs of life and survival.

First leadership

When Guan Yu was walking five levels and slashing six generals, Liao Hua met Guan Yu on the way, and when he heard of Guan Yu's name, Liao Hua immediately decided to give up his original free life like a mountain thief, and he was willing to return to Guan Yu's account, and from then on he would reform himself and strive to achieve fame as soon as possible! Guan Yu, who was also a well-known martial artist at that time, may need talents, but he did not need to use them, and he arranged Liao Hua, who was outstanding in martial arts, in the position of the main book. (This master book is mainly responsible for matters related to clerical matters.) )

At the time of Guan Yu's Northern Expedition, Liao Hua should have made meritorious achievements with him, but due to the relationship between his positions, Liao Hua had no military power at all. Later, after the defeat of Guan Yu's army, he was helplessly taken in by Sun Quan.

Second leadership

As mentioned above, after Guan Yu's defeat, Liao Hua was naturally absorbed by Sun Quan's troops. Liao Hua's supreme leader at that time was definitely Sun Quan. Sun Wu's people were very disgusted with the people of Shuzhong, not to mention that Liao Hua was a general, even if Zhuge Liang went, it was estimated that he would not be welcome. Later, Liao Hua could not continue to mix in Eastern Wu, and used the method of fake death to deceive the Wu people at that time and successfully sneaked back in the direction of Shu Han.

Third leadership

At this time, Liao Hua was no longer the "little bastard" who had followed Guan Yu, at least he had seen it, and it was a big deal! He felt that Liu Bei was still reliable before, so he risked his life and quietly returned to Shuzhong with his family.

In 222 AD, just after the Spring Festival, Liu Bei could not wait to order an attack on Eastern Wu. On the way to Eastern Wu, the army happened to encounter the gray-headed Liao Hua, and they miraculously met in Zigui. After a brief greeting, Liao Hua was directly reused by Liu Bei, who then made him "Taishou of Yidu Commandery." "And, personally take him to participate in the battle against Wu."

After Liu Bei's defeat, Liao Hua followed the remnants of the army and returned to Chengdu as he wished. But what awaits him is only a harsh examination. Because at this time, he met a leader who was more shrewd than Guan Yu, smarter than Liu Bei, and more aware of Tianji than Sun Quan, Zhuge Liang.

After Liu Bei ascended to heaven, all the affairs of Shu Han fell to Zhuge Liang. Including, Liao Hua this name, smuggling people. After several years of examination, Zhuge Liang said that Liao Hua could indeed be used, so he let Liao Hua join the army as Ren Cheng Xiang. This time it was more reliable, and the position was finally biased towards the military attaché.

However, what is surprising is that in 234 AD, Zhuge Liang died in the Northern Expedition. It can be said that although I met a good leader this time, it is a pity that it is only a flash in the pan!

Fifth leader

With his previous inaugural experience, Liao Hua successfully reached out to the next leader. Jiang Huan, this person is very real, and at the same time he is also a person recommended by the former leader Zhuge Liang, and it should be right to follow him!

In 238 AD, Liao Hua did defeat You Yi and made a battle achievement. The time soon arrived, and in 248, this year, Liao Hua also helped the Shu army successfully meet the Hu King, further contributing to the population growth of the Shu Han. Unfortunately, the leader of Liao Hua this year is not the previous Jiang Huan, the old Jiang has already died of illness 2 years ago.

Sixth leader

After Liao Hua's experience with Jiang Huan, his leader was Fei Yi. At that time, Liu Chan engaged in job differentiation, and it was Fei Yi who controlled the military, and Liao Hua was naturally a subordinate of Fei Yi, who was under the control of Fei Yi.

Fei Yi was a very capable and talented man, and in 252, he was reused by the later lord Liu Chan! Unfortunately, what is unexpected is that just after the Spring Festival in the next year, Fei Yi was assassinated by the assassins and retired early. Liao Hua, I almost wanted to cry.

Seventh leader

Successively, after Guan Yu, Sun Quan, Liu Bei, Zhuge Liang, Jiang Wan, and Fei Yi, will Liao Hua's last leader take him to eat chicken and walk to the peak of his life?

Liao Hua's last leader was Zhuge Liang's "descendant" Jiang Wei. For Jiang Wei, he is talented, but he has been using soldiers for many years, and he has long lost the best time to attack, but what about Jiang Wei? Still refusing to give up, it eventually led to being attacked by Deng Ai and being dumplingten by Cao Wei.

Although there have been several leaders, for Liao Hua, there seems to be no reliable one, which is really tragic. In the later period, it was even more left, "there is no general in Shu, Liao hua is a pioneer" scandal! This makes people think about it, sigh!

In 263 AD, after Zhuge Zhan's defeat, Liu Chan actually chose to surrender without a fight! Later, Liao Hua died of illness on the way to Luoyang after following Liu Chan (said to have died of illness, it is estimated that most of them were killed by anger!). )
